The Columbus Pet Expo was a great success.  We gave out tons of free
literature (including over 110 copies of Pam Greene's mini-faq) until
everything was gone, talked to lots of people (both ferret owners and
owner-wannabes) about ferret care, shared cute ferret stories, let people
cuddle ferrets, sold books, clear dryer hoses, magazines and crock-locs, and
took in two rescues.
